23 Şubat 2015 Pazartesi

HTML Şifreleme Source Code


Merhaba arkadaşlar.
Bu yazımda sizlere html şifrelemek için gerekli source'yi vereceğim. Bu vereceğim source html dosyanızı şifrelemeye yarar. Kullanımı gayet basit. Aşağıdaki kodu kopyalayıp metin editörüne yapıştırın daha sonra kendinize göre düzenleyin.

<script language="JavaScript">function doencrypt(theform) {  if (theform.code.value == "") {    alert("No HTML code to encrypt");    return false;  } else {    enctext=encrypt(theform.code.value);    EncCode="<Script Language='Javascript'>\n";    EncCode+="<!-- HTML Encryption By WhisPer -->\n";    EncCode+="<!--\n";    EncCode+="document.write(unescape('"+enctext+"'));\n";    EncCode+="//-->\n";    EncCode+="</Script\>";    theform.ecode.value=EncCode;    theform.sac.disabled = false;  } return false;}
function sandc(thisform) {  thisform.ecode.focus();  thisform.ecode.select();}
function encrypt(tx) {  var hex='';  var i;  for (i=0; i<tx.length; i++) {    hex += '%'+hexfromdec(tx.charCodeAt(i))  }  return hex;}
function hexfromdec(num) {  if (num > 65535) {    return ("err!")  }  first = Math.round(num/4096 - .5);  temp1 = num - first * 4096;  second = Math.round(temp1/256 -.5);  temp2 = temp1 - second * 256;  third = Math.round(temp2/16 - .5);  fourth = temp2 - third * 16;  return (""+getletter(third)+getletter(fourth));}
function getletter(num) {  if (num < 10) {    return num;  } else {    if (num == 10) {      return "A"    }    if (num == 11) {      return "B"    }    if (num == 12) {      return "C"    }    if (num == 13) {      return "D"    }    if (num == 14) {      return "E"    }    if (num == 15) {      return "F"    }  }}
</script>
<h2 class="title">Turboindir.org</h2>    <div class="entry">    <div class="box">


            <form name="pageform" onSubmit="return doencrypt(this);">

            <div  class="tooltop" style="height;76px;">
            <div class="tcat">Turboindir.org</div>            <div style="height:28px;" class="alt1">1. html kodunuzu ilk kutuya yerleştirin.<br>            2. Daha sonra Şifreleye tıklayıp kodunuzu alabilirsiniz..</div>            <div style="line-height:20px;width:80%;">&nbsp;</div>            <div style="height:28px;" class="alt1">HTMl Kodunuz:</div> </tr>            <div style="padding-left:10px;">            <textarea rows="11" name="code" id="area1" cols="90"></textarea>            </div>            <div style="height:21px;" class="alt1">            <input type="submit" id="gonder" onClick="doencrypt(pageform);" value="Şifrele!" style="float: left"></div>            </div>            <div style="height:40px;">&nbsp;</div>            <div style="padding-left:10px;">            <textarea rows="11" id="area2" readonly name="ecode" cols="90"></textarea></div>            <div class="alt1"> <input type="button" value="Hepsini Seç" onClick="sandc(pageform);" name="sac" disabled="true" style="float: left"></div>           </form>            <div class="clear"></div>    </div>


ifadelerifadeler